OII Hedge Fund Activity: Q4 2019 in Review

215 of the 5,075 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in Oceaneering (OII) for Q4 2019, worth a combined $1.45B — up 14% from $1.27B a quarter earlier.

Buyers outnumbered sellers: 48 funds opened new OII positions and 32 closed out — a net gain of 16 holders — while 76 added to existing stakes and 74 trimmed.

The largest buyer was BlackRock, adding an estimated $58.6M. The largest seller was Citadel Advisors, cutting an estimated $38M.
